Rule-Driven, Fully-Configurable Asset Tracking with GISSSP Innovations
For the last seven years MLGW has successfully implemented GIS using ArcGIS/ArcFM ™. The GIS serves as an enterprise backbone for a variety of business applications where utility assets play a crucial role: Inspection, Maintenance, New Construction, OMS, among others.To support the life cycle of MLGW’s assets, SSP has implemented a rule-driven and fully-configurable asset tracking mechanism built into the GIS. Rules specified by different business units determine: What network elements are to be tracked as assets. What attributes of those assets are to be monitored. How and when these attributes may change.

GIS Based Power Distribution System: A Case study for the Junagadh Cityijsrd.com
In this paper power distribution data (poles, transformers and transmission lines) have been mapped using GPS and high resolution remote sensing images. These details have been put in GIS using ArcGIS 9.1 software. Various things like road network and land use are also superimposed on the power distribution system GIS layer. Various types of analysis like finding a pole or circuit of specific transformer can be done using GIS tools.

Neuro-symbolic is not enough, we need neuro-*semantic*Frank van Harmelen
Neuro-symbolic (NeSy) AI is on the rise. However, simply machine learning on just any symbolic structure is not sufficient to really harvest the gains of NeSy. These will only be gained when the symbolic structures have an actual semantics. I give an operational definition of semantics as “predictable inference”.
All of this illustrated with link prediction over knowledge graphs, but the argument is general.
